Tryfen Gribilco is a Central Otago farmer who runs a bungy jump platform with a young, by-the-book offsider Marty Wellings. Tryfen is perfectly untouched by the ravages of political correctness, and has an opinion on just about everything. Finding he has a captive audience in the clients he has trussed up on his bridge, he sounds off on anything and everything without being the least bit concerned who he might be offending.

Marty is torn between his genuine affection for his slap-happy and over-opinionated boss, and his need to keep the clients safe and happy. He’s concerned that due to Tryfen's propensity for dialogue (or monologue) with the clients, they are not getting through many jumps, and their boss KJ, who’s turning up later that day, may not be happy.

Their clients for the day include an urbane Australian politician and his daughter, and an uptight German UN delegate and her assistant. By the time Tryfen has schooled them all on life in general and the finer points of global geo-politics, Marty is becoming extremely agitated about his job security. But confirmed bachelor Tryfen is about to get a lesson of his own when Dutch backpacker Heidi turns up.
